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PM2BP4_Strong
The NM_018332.5(DDX19A):āc.101C>Gā(p.Thr34Ser)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000149 in 1,611,136 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 13/20 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(ā ).

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| Ambry Genetics | Nov 07, 2022 | The c.101C>G (p.T34S) alteration is located in exon 2 (coding exon 2) of the DDX19A gene. This alteration results from a C to G substitution at nucleotide position 101, causing the threonine (T) at amino acid position 34 to be replaced by a serine (S).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. - |
